## Changed defaults — LagSentinel 3.2

Heads up: we finally tightened the read-replica lag alarm defaults. The old threshold of five minutes was a relic from when Pondwick ran on a single replica, and it let genuinely bad lag simmer unnoticed. The new defaults alert at ninety seconds sustained, with a shorter evaluation window and a saner cooldown so you don't get paged in bursts. If you were relying on the loose settings, override them explicitly. The new shipped defaults are as follows.

config for hahip-kaguf:
[holath]
port = 8443
region = north-4
host = holath.tolvaqlabs.internal
timeout_ms = 1000
retries = 2

MEMO — Board Members

Re: Sale of the Fernholt Packaging unit

Quick update: the sale of Fernholt Packaging to Bryce & Alder Holdings is moving along nicely. Diligence wrapped last week with no surprises, and their counsel sent a revised draft that keeps our preferred indemnity terms. We expect to sign before month-end and close roughly six weeks after. Staff communications are drafted and ready. One thing we haven't shared outside this group yet is summarized in the note below.

management briefing: Ralokix Partners plans to lower the Istath list price by 38 percent in October.

## Onboarding — Markdown Pipeline (Inkmere)

Inkmere docs render through a three-stage pipeline: parse, sanitize, emit. Releases rebuild all templates; never hot-patch emitted HTML. Broken renders usually mean a sanitizer rule change — check the rules diff first. The render cluster only accepts builds from the release channel, and every build artifact must be signed before upload. Sign artifacts with the deploy key below.

release key, hafop-tajef: bky13_s2vaFVNJTHfBL